Mack is mad as all hell. This time, all the stops were out. Mack Bolan became a single-minded, death-spewing avenger the minute Eve disappeared.... Someone he cared about, Eve had been swallowed up by the voracious blood thirst of international terror. Bolan stalked the savages responsible deep into the labyrinth of double-dealing and betrayal that marks modern terrorism. The hunt took him from the lush Caribbean to the scorching Sahara in pursuit of the Libyan connection that held the fate of civilization in its grasp. For The Executioner, it was the toughest mission yet, fueled by the most righteous revenge. Anyone who got in his way...was dead.
